Course content and objectives
Dieses Studium ist kein alternatives Medizinstudium, d.h. es darf das originäre Medizinstudium nicht ersetzen. Der PA erwirbt im Studium die formalen Voraussetzungen, um weisungsgebunden, delegierbare Tätigkeiten an Patienten selbständig unter Berücksichtigung ethischer und betriebswirtschaftlicher Gesichtspunkte auszuüben, die zuvor vom Arzt übernommen wurden. Erstmalig bietet die staatliche Hochschule Anhalt das Studium zum PA mit dem Schwerpunkt „hausärztlich-ambulante Medizin“, basierend auf einer breitangelegten praxisorientierten Ausbildung, an. Es handelt sich um einen 7-semestrigen Studiengang, bei dem die Studierenden in einem Arbeitsverhältnis stehen, daneben einen akademischen Abschluss erwerben und die Ausbildungsinhalte sofort in die Praxis umsetzen können. Das Studium setzt sich aus Präsenz-/Seminarphasen, Transfer-/Praxisphasen und Selbstlernphasen zusammen. Es beinhaltet Studienmodule mit Präsenzpflicht, die als theoretische Lehrveranstaltungen (online/physisch) angeboten werden sowie praktische Seminare, die an der Hochschule oder kooperierenden Kliniken oder Praxen absolviert werden. Über die gesamte Dauer des Studiums wird ein wissenschaftliches Projekt bearbeitet, an dessen Ende die Bachelorarbeit steht. Dieses Projekt wird in der Regel vom Arbeitgeber mitbetreut.

What is Physician Assistance?
The PA is not a physician: diagnosis and therapy procedures remain the sole responsibility of the licensed physician. The PA is an interface between the physician and the healthcare professional. They cannot and may not legally replace the doctor, but they may act in a supportive capacity. During their studies, PAs acquire the formal prerequisites in order to be able to conduct, under instruction, specific procedures on patients and with reference to ethical and business management considerations.
-
What does the degree program entail?
The aim is to expand specialist and patient-oriented care in order to increase the efficiency of personnel deployment by reducing the assistance provided by medical staff. The degree program is application and action-oriented. It imparts medical and scientific knowledge to the effect that graduates are qualified to act as physicians within the framework of delegation, but without practicing medicine.
-
What kind of work might await successful graduates
Current areas of employment and activity for PAs include most internal medicine and surgery specialties in clinical settings (trauma surgery, orthopedics, geriatrics, emergency department, neurology, gastroenterology, cardiology, surgery, wound and vascular medicine).
Due to the current situation of outpatient care by general practitioners, especially in rural areas, the PA would also provide medical patient care delegated by physicians in private practices / health centers (MVZ).

Frequently Asked Questions
-
Can previous academic achievements be credited?
- Previous academic achievements from training, e.g. VERAH training and/or a first degree program and/or after a change of degree program or university and/or studies abroad, which were completed at another university (see credit modalities in the Program and Examination Regulations), can be credited on application after enrollment.
- The Examinations Committee for your Department is responsible for this in coordination with the respective Degree Program Advisor / lecturers / academic director.
-
Is the PA a state-recognized degree?
- Anhalt University of Applied Sciences is a state university and therefore it is a state-recognized degree program.
- With regard to the PA as a professional qualification, however, there is currently no state recognition, although this is planned in the future.
- As this is a new degree program, it has not yet been accredited, but this should be accomplished in the near future.
-
Are employment and internships also possible in cl
- In addition to GP and outpatient practices, internships can also be carried out in clinics.
- Furthermore, the required professional experience can also be acquired in clinics.
- The applicant's current employment may also be at a clinic.
-
How do the transfer/practice phases work?
Competence internships as well as transfer days in each semester take place in the facilities (clinic / practice / health center (MVZ)) of the employer or in so-called training competence centers (AKZ) are designed to help students enhance knowledge acquired in class by applying it in the professional field.
-
How are the examinations organized?
These include written examinations, oral examinations - both of which usually have to be taken in person at the Köthen campus - and term papers, which have to be completed each semester. In the 7th semester students complete and defend the bachelor thesis.
Under special conditions, previous academic achievements from degree programs and/or training already completed can be credited. Modules already completed, e.g. in the course of VERAH training, can also be credited (see credit regulations in the Program and Examination Regulations).
